A living trust is created in Delaware by signing a Declaration of Trust, which will name the trustee, beneficiary and terms of the trust. You need to sign the declaration in the presence of a notary. Once that is complete, the trust must be funded by transferring assets into it.
Delaware Statutory Trusts typically require a minimum investment of $100,000, and an investor can acquire or exchange into ownership in one or multiple DSTs. DST real estate is generally held for 3 to 10 years.
To make a living trust in Delaware, you: Choose whether to make an individual or shared trust. Decide what property to include in the trust. Choose a successor trustee. Decide who will be the trusts beneficiariesthat is, who will get the trust property. Create the trust document.

Delaware law holds that the creator of a trust has the legal right to control the investment, management and trust distribution decisions of trusts he or she creates. Trustors can define the rights of beneficiaries and determine the duties, powers and standards of a fiduciary.
A DST is easy to form and maintain A DST is formed by filing a certificate of trust with the Office of the Secretary of State of the State of Delaware. This certificate states only the name of the trust and the name and address of the Delaware trustee.
